I agree that a student really should visit U of C. I lived in Hyde Park for 8 years and crime in the immediate neighborhood was never a huge daily worry though of course there was a typical amount of urban crime. U of is a very unique school with a big emphasis on a classic core curriculum which a student should be certain they are interested in before applying. Additionally the school is predominantly a graduate school so there is a very different campus atmosphere than you find in most other schools that are predominantly undergraduate. Northwestern of course has it’s own personality and vibe but it’s not nearly as taste specific as U of C is. With a 3.5 GPA unless you really would like to visit Chicago I probably would wait.
